  3. FINEMAN, IRVING (18931976), U.S. novelist. Born in New York, Fineman served in the navy during World War i, and worked as an engineer until 1929, when he turned to writing. His first two novels, This Pure Young Man (1930) and Lovers Must Learn (1932), dealt with American themes.
